1) Scalp massage

Massaging the scalp is a simple and inexpensive remedy for hair loss from stress. It helps promote blood circulation to the hair follicles, which provides essential nutrients and oxygen for hair growth.

Additionally, scalp massage helps reduce stress levels, which can contribute to hair growth. You can use natural oils like coconut oil or olive oil to massage your scalp gently and leave it on for a few hours before washing it off.


2) Essential oils

Essential oils like peppermint oil, lavender oil and rosemary oil have been shown to have hair growth-promoting effects.

These oils promote blood circulation to the scalp and stimulate the hair follicles, leading to healthier hair growth. Additionally, the calming and stress-reducing effects of these oils can help reduce hair loss caused by stress.


3) Nutrient-rich diet

Consuming a diet rich in nutrients like vitamins, minerals and proteins can help reduce hair loss caused by stress.

Foods like fish, eggs, spinach and nuts provide essential nutrients that promote hair health. Additionally, drinking plenty of water helps keep the body hydrated, which is essential for healthy hair growth.


4) Minoxidil treatment

Minoxidil is a medication that's used to treat hair loss. It works by promoting blood circulation to the hair follicles, stimulating hair growth. Minoxidil has been shown to be effective in treating hair loss caused by stress.


5) Platelet-rich plasma therapy

PRP therapy combined with micro needling is another effective treatment for hair loss from stress.

Microneedling involves creating tiny punctures in the scalp to promote collagen production and stimulate hair growth. When PRP, which contains growth factors, is applied to the scalp during micro needling, it enhances the effectiveness of both treatments.


6) Yoga and meditation

Practicing yoga and meditation can help reduce stress levels, which in turn can help reduce hair loss.

Yoga helps increase blood circulation to the scalp, which promotes hair growth. Additionally, mindfulness practices like meditation can help reduce stress levels, which can contribute to hair loss.


7) Hair supplements

Certain hair supplements, like biotin, vitamin D and iron supplements, can help promote hair growth. These supplements provide essential nutrients that promote healthy hair growth and reduce hair loss caused by stress.


8) Laser therapy

Laser therapy, also known as low-level light therapy, involves using low-level lasers to stimulate hair growth.

The lasers work by promoting blood circulation to the hair follicles, which increases delivery of nutrients and oxygen to promote healthier and stronger hair growth. This non-invasive treatment has been shown to be effective in reducing hair loss from stress.


9) Acupuncture

Acupuncture is an ancient Chinese therapy that involves inserting thin needles into specific points on the body to promote healing and balance of energy flow.

In the case of hair loss from stress, acupuncture can help reduce stress levels, improve blood circulation to the scalp and stimulate hair follicles.


10) Onion juice treatment

Onion juice is a popular home remedy for hair loss from stress. Onions contain sulfur, which is known to improve blood circulation to the hair follicles, stimulate hair growth and strengthen hair strands.

Research has shown that applying onion juice to the scalp can boost production of collagen, which is essential for healthy hair growth.

To make onion juice, simply blend a few onions, and extract the juice. Massage the onion juice into your scalp, and leave it on for 15-30 minutes before rinsing it off with a gentle shampoo.
